Digital innovation supports data gathering for better fisheries management

Factsheet

Description

The resource “Digital innovation supports data gathering for better fisheries management” is designed to strengthen the collection, standardisation and use of fisheries data for effective management decisions. Effective fisheries management involves decisions about the utilization of fish stocks, species selection, fishing locations, seasons, and catch limits while balancing social and economic gains with the preservation of marine ecosystems. The resource explains that access to reliable and up-to-date data is critical and presents FAO-developed tools and platforms that supply the data needed to facilitate the effective management of fisheries at national, regional and global levels.

The resource presents three core digital tools. The AdriaMed Trawl Survey Information System (ATrIS) is a digital database platform designed to store, organize, retrieve and process data on the abundance and spatial distribution of demersal species collected through bottom trawl surveys. Calipseo is a web-based application that integrates diverse data sources and applies standard classifications and methodologies to generate fisheries statistics for policymaking and reporting. The Fisheries Performance Assessment Toolkit (FPAT) is a simulation-based digital assessment tool where fishery data are uploaded into an application that models different management interventions and supports trade-off analysis for data-limited fisheries.

Impact

The AdriaMed Trawl Survey Information System is used by over 17 research institutions in the Mediterranean region and has become the de facto reference data management tool for several Mediterranean countries. The Fisheries Performance Assessment Toolkit was successfully piloted in 10 fisheries over a five-year period with researchers, fishers, fish workers, the private sector and decision-makers in Cabo Verde, Côte d’Ivoire, Ecuador, Indonesia and Senegal. As of June 2024, FAO mobile data collection platforms are fully operational in Saint Lucia, Suriname and Trinidad and Tobago, are being piloted in Bangladesh, Grenada and Lebanon, and are in initial implementation stages in Guyana, with plans for deployment in Cameroon, Côte d’Ivoire, Dominica and Egypt.
